Test Details & Preparation


  • C - reactive protein test is done to identify the presence of inflammation and to monitor response to treatment for an inflammatory disorder.

  • C - reactive protein test is performed when your doctor suspects that you have an acute condition causing inflammation, such as a serious bacterial or fungal infection or when you are suffering from an inflammatory disorder such as arthritis, an autoimmune disorder, or inflammatory bowel disease.

  • A blood sample taken from a vein in your arm for a C - reactive protein test.

  • No preparation is needed for a C - reactive protein test.

  • The level of CRP in the blood is normally low.

  • A high or increasing amount of CRP in the blood suggests the presence of inflammation but will not identify its location or the cause. In individuals suspected of having a serious bacterial infection, a high CRP can be confirmatory.

  • If the CRP level is initially elevated and drops, it means that the inflammation or infection is subsiding or responding to treatment.
